Box Score The Misericordia University women's lacrosse team dropped a 21-11 decision to Lebanon Valley, Saturday afternoon at Mangelsdorf Field.
Allie Elmes had three goals for the Cougars while
Melina Juliano and
Emily Hegner both added two scores. Jeny Perucca had a goal and an assist.
The Cougars took an early lead on
Jenny Perucca's free-position goal just two minutes into the game.
After Lebanon Valley answered with two straight goals, Juliano raced down the middle and took a feed from Perucca from behind the net to tie it, 2-2, at 22:58.
Elmes put the Cougars back in front with a free-position goal at 21:28, but the Dutchmen scored three straight goals to take a 5-3 lead.
Emily Hegner charged down the left side of the lane to get MU within a goal, but LVC answered with five straight goals to take a 10-4 lead with 5:14 to play in the first half.
Elmes made a nice move to avoid two defenders at the top of the circle and drove down the middle to make it 10-5, but Leb Val scored three more times before halftime to take a 13-5 lead.
Kate Pagnotta opened the second half with a free-position goal, but LVC scored three straight goals to go up, 16-6, with 14:27 remaining.
Hegner started a 4-0 MU run with an unassisted goal and
Brooke North followed with a man-up goal.
Liz Mulvey and Elmes both scored free-position goals to cut the margin to 16-10, with 8:23 to play.
After the Dutchmen scored four consecutive goals, Juliano tallied MU's final goal with 1:21 to go.
Misericordia will host Alvernia, Tuesday.
